The UC2526DWTR is a sophisticated power management integrated circuit (IC) designed and manufactured by Texas Instruments, a leader in the semiconductor industry. This IC is tailored for a range of applications that require precise and efficient power control, including but not limited to power supplies, motor controllers, and various industrial systems.
Key Features
- Adjustable Output Voltage: The UC2526DWTR provides users with the ability to adjust the output voltage to meet specific requirements, ensuring versatility across different applications.
- High-Performance Topology: It features advanced control circuitry that enables high-performance topologies, such as push-pull or bridge configurations, enhancing the efficiency and reliability of the power supply system.
- Pulse-by-Pulse Current Limiting: The integrated pulse-by-pulse current limiting protects the IC from overcurrent conditions, thereby increasing the safety and longevity of the device.
- Under-Voltage Lockout (UVLO): With UVLO, the UC2526DWTR ensures that the system operates only when the supply voltage is within an acceptable range, preventing damage from low voltage conditions.
- Soft-Start Functionality: The soft-start feature gradually increases the output voltage at startup, reducing stress on the power supply components and enhancing system stability.
- Thermal Shutdown: An internal thermal shutdown mechanism provides additional protection by turning off the IC if the junction temperature exceeds safe operating limits.
